Transaction ec6110682c37582e843dd2ab7ebb21590ad953cfa2d09cf371ab5a5d693202f3
1 Input
1 Output
-
ec6110682c37582e843dd2ab7ebb21590ad953cfa2d09cf371ab5a5d693202f3:0
- value
- 112113
- script pubkey
- OP_0 OP_PUSHBYTES_20 5b43f7764663ed0c5fe2f64fa9a7f0936aac180c
- address
- bc1qtdplwajxv0kschlz7e86nflsjd42cxqvq5uflq